Foundation Repair Services
Fo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the stability of a building’s foundation when issues such as settling, cracking, or shifting are detected. These services typically include evaluating the extent of damage, identifying underlying causes, and implementing solutions to reinforce or stabilize the foundation. Common rep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or the installation of support systems designed to prevent further movement and protect the structural integrity of the property.
These repairs address a variety of problems that can compromise a building’s safety and longevity. Signs of foundation issues often include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. Addressing these problems early can prevent more extensive damage, such as structural failure or costly repairs, and help maintain the property's value and usability over time.
Foundation repair services are applicable to a range of property types, including residential hom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ial structures. Both new constructions experiencing settling problems and older properties with aging foundations may require such services. Properties built on expansive soils, with poor drainage, or exposed to significant moisture fluctuations are particularly susceptible to foundation issues that may necessitate professional repair work.

Foundation Repair Cost -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of damage and the repair method used. For example, min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while extensive underpinning can reach $15,000 or more. Costs vary based on the size and complexity of the project.
Type of Repair - Repair costs differ by type, with crack injections averaging between $1,000 and $3,000, and full foundation replacement often exceeding $30,000. The choice of repair method influences the overall expense, with some solutions being more labor-intensive and costly.
Location Factors - Costs can vary based on geographic location, with areas like West Boylston, MA, typically seeing prices within the national range. Local contractor rates and soil conditions may impact the final cost, making estimates vary accordingly.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s such as soil stabilization or drainage improvements can add $1,000 to $5,000 to the project. These additional services are often recommended to ensure long-term stability and may be included in the overall repair estimate.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or do not close properly, and gaps around door frames or moldings.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to a home? Some level of disruption is possible, such as minor noise or temporary loss of access to certain areas, but experienced contractors aim to minimize inconvenience.
What causes foundation problems in West Boylston, MA? Common causes include soil movement, moisture changes, poor drainage, and tree root intrusion, which can lead to settling or shifting of the foundation.
